The Witch joins the ranks of It Follows and House of the Devil in this new age of modern horror films that put slightly more emphasis on mood and tone than on spectacle, i.e. prosthetics or set pieces. Beautiful cinematography and editing. Just know what you're in for.

In the tradition of the masterworks of Carl Theodor Dreyer and Andrei Tarkovsky, Robert Eggers visually stunning The Witch is full of phantasmagoric and surrealist imagery that excites the senses and rattles the nerves. Recommended.
